LS101C-GS08 Details

  • Manufacturer Part Number:

    LS101C-GS08

  • Rohs Code:

    Yes

  • Part Life Cycle Code:

    Active

  • Country Of Origin:

    Mainland China

  • ECCN Code:

    EAR99

  • HTS Code:

    8541.10.00.70

  • Factory Lead Time:

    10 Weeks

  • Manufacturer:

    Vishay Intertechnologies

  • YTEOL:

    6

  • Additional Feature:

    LOW LEAKAGE CURRENT

  • Application:

    GENERAL PURPOSE

  • Case Connection:

    ISOLATED

  • Configuration:

    SINGLE

  • Diode Element Material:

    SILICON

  • Diode Type:

    RECTIFIER DIODE

  • Forward Voltage-Max (VF):

    0.39 V

  • JEDEC-95 Code:

    DO-213AA

  • JESD-30 Code:

    O-LELF-R2

  • JESD-609 Code:

    e3

  • Moisture Sensitivity Level:

    1

  • Non-rep Pk Forward Current-Max:

    2 A

  • Number of Elements:

    1

  • Number of Phases:

    1

  • Number of Terminals:

    2

  • Operating Temperature-Max:

    125 °C

  • Output Current-Max:

    0.03 A

  • Package Body Material:

    GLASS

  • Package Shape:

    ROUND

  • Package Style:

    LONG FORM

  • Peak Reflow Temperature (Cel):

    260

  • Qualification Status:

    Not Qualified

  • Rep Pk Reverse Voltage-Max:

    40 V

  • Surface Mount:

    YES

  • Technology:

    SCHOTTKY

  • Terminal Finish:

    Tin (Sn)

  • Terminal Form:

    WRAP AROUND

  • Terminal Position:

    END

  • Time@Peak Reflow Temperature-Max (s):

    30

LS101C-GS08 Frequently Asked Questions (FAQs)

  • The recommended storage temperature range for LS101C-GS08 is -40°C to 125°C, as per Vishay's general guidelines for storage and handling of semiconductor devices.
  • While the LS101C-GS08 is a general-purpose Schottky rectifier, it's not optimized for high-frequency applications. For high-frequency applications, consider using a Schottky rectifier specifically designed for high-frequency use, such as the VS-101CQ015-M3.
  • To ensure reliability in high-temperature environments, follow proper derating guidelines, ensure good thermal management, and consider using a heat sink if necessary. Additionally, consult Vishay's application notes and reliability data for guidance.
  • While the LS101C-GS08 meets the general requirements for automotive applications, it's essential to verify compliance with specific automotive standards, such as AEC-Q101, and consult with Vishay's automotive-qualified products and application notes.
  • The recommended soldering temperature profile for LS101C-GS08 is a peak temperature of 260°C for 10 seconds, with a ramp-up rate of 3°C/s and a ramp-down rate of 6°C/s. Consult Vishay's soldering guidelines for more information.
